A story about this was in today's "McDonough County Voice".

The South Dakota Board of Regents will now allow multi-year contracts to certain head coaches, athletic directors, and public university presidents.

Bob Nielson had agreed to a $255,000 annual salary. But Nielson was seeking a long-term commitment and state policy only allowed one-year contracts.
